| Lunokite Mineral Data |
General Lunokite Information |
|||
| (Mn,Ca)(Mg,Fe++,Mn)Al(PO4)2(OH)·4(H2O) | |||
| Molecular Weight = 396.13 gm | |||
| Calcium 2.02 % Ca 2.83 % CaO | |||
| Magnesium 2.45 % Mg 4.07 % MgO | |||
| Manganese 15.26 % Mn 19.70 % MnO | |||
| Aluminum 7.49 % Al 14.16 % Al2O3 | |||
| Iron 2.82 % Fe 3.63 % FeO | |||
| Phosphorus 15.64 % P 35.83 % P2O5 | |||
| Hydrogen 2.21 % H 19.78 % H2O | |||
| Oxygen 52.10 % O | |||
| ______ ______ | |||
| 100.00 % 100.00 % = TOTAL OXIDE | |||
| Mn2+0.8Ca0.2Mg0.4Fe2+0.2Mn2+0.3Al1.1(PO4)2(OH)1.1·3.8(H2O) | |||
| In fractures and on crusts of mitridatite in granite pegmatites. | |||
| Approved IMA 1983 | |||
| On Mt. Vasin-Myl'k, Voron'i massif, Kola Peninsula, Russia. Link to MinDat.org Location Data. | |||
| Named for the Lun'ok River, nearby Mt. Vasin-Myl'k, Russia. | |||

Lunokite Crystallography |
|||
| a:b:c =0.799:1:0.3719 | |||
| a = 14.95, b = 18.71, c = 6.96, Z = 8; V = 1,946.81 Den(Calc)= 2.70 | |||
| Orthorhombic - DipyramidalH-M Symbol (2/m 2/m 2/m) Space Group: P bca | |||
| By Intensity(I/Io): 2.809(1), 9.39(0.9), 2.92(0.7), | |||

Optical Properties of Lunokite |
|||
| CI meas= -0.032 (Excellent) - where the CI = (1-KPDmeas/KC) CI calc= -0.017 (Superior) - where the CI = (1-KPDcalc/KC) KPDcalc= 0.2256,KPDmeas= 0.2289,KC= 0.2219 |
|||
| Biaxial (+), a=1.603, b=1.608, g=1.616, bire=0.0130, 2V(Calc)=78, 2V(Meas)=70. Dispersion r > v. | |||
